I'm brewing the following beer:

10 lbs Floor Malted MO
1 lb Crystal MO

US05 yeast


I have the following hops, in large quantities:

Amarillo
Simcoe
Cascade
Citra
Chinook
Centennial
(seeing the picture)
Hersbrucker
Willamette
Warrior
Nugget

What hops would you recommend putting with the MO?


:mug:
 
First instinct would be to bitter with Warrior and finish with equal portions of Cascade and Willamette.
